To mark the International Mother’s Day, Bollywood stars Akshay Kumar, Alia Bhatt, Karan Johar and Ranveer Singh revisited their special moments with their moms by sharing some old, candid pictures.
The celebrities took to Twitter to show their love for their mothers.
“To my #FirstFriend wishing you #HappyMothersDay! Life begins & ends with you. Thank you for being you Mom,” Akshay tweeted alongside an old photo of himself seated next to his mother at a function.

“My world then. My world now. Happy Mother’s Day to my creator, mentor, lighthouse,” wrote Nimrat Kaur. She captioned it with a picture of a baby Nimrat in the arms of her mother in a garden.
Ranveer Singh with his usual tongue-in-cheek humour wrote, “Mommys Angel and mommys Rascal ! #throwback #LoveYouMom.” He posted a picture, showing his mother wrapping her arms around a young Ranveer, who is scratching his head.
Actress Bipasha Basu tweeted, “Happy Mother’s Day to my beautiful Ma. The most amazing mother in the world,” with a picture of herself and her mother smiling to the camera.

Alia Bhat tweeted, “One day is not enough to celebrate your worth.. Could take me more than a lifetime. I love you. #HappyMothersDay.”
ALia Bhatt posted a picture, showing her filmmaker mother Soni Razdan posing with her as a toddler Alia.
